Cannoli follwed Darkleaf into the territory nervously. She'd never been outside twolegplace before. White noise buzzed in her ears and she missed the constant noise of the human hustle and bustle. She licked the bandana around her neck.

Glancing up the tree, she saw the squirrel that the loner had pointed out. She listened carefully to her instructions.

"Ch-chase it up the tree?" she stammered, not quite willing to let the other molly know she's never climbed a tree before. She paced cautiously to the tree as silently as possible, glancing up to be sure the fluffy creature hadn't run away.

It can't be much harder than climbing my cat condo, right? she thought, but still wasn't convinced. The fluffy siamese cat stretched up and sank her claws into the tree bark. She hauled herself slowly up to the first branch, pupils dialated with fear. She willed herself to keep her breath quiet and even so as not to scare her prey. The she-cat was painfully aware of Darkleaf watching her. She crept forward along the branch, trembling with every step as it swayed under her weight.

The squirrel was half of a tail-length away and Cannoli bunched her haunches and crouched, trembling, trying to work up the courage to leap. Just do it, Cannoli! Just go for it! She closed her eyes and leapt forward, claws outsretched to catch the squirrel. Her claws caught in it's tail and she bit it quickly out of instict, but one of her hind paws missed the branch and she slipped. Shrieking with fear, Cannoli dug her claws into the branch and hung by her forepaws, squirrel held firmly in her jaws.

"Darkleaf! Help!" she cried desperately, voice muffled by fur.
